Output 11621488d112f9419f73356872200ff9df1a30c174ff7cb5b21b82061a875011:0

value
409855383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6382c27b242400efd4bbf535abaac31d59d3db0 OP_EQUAL
address
MRyFKLxpCa89FpJNQ4bVYxKMnqy9uzYq1C
transaction
11621488d112f9419f73356872200ff9df1a30c174ff7cb5b21b82061a875011
spent
true